squid-cache: Squid vulnerable to information disclosure via authentication credential leakage in error handling
A Information Disclosure vulnerability has been identified in the Squid web caching proxy. This flaw occurs when the application fails to properly redact sensitive Hypertext Transfer Protocol HTTP authentication credentials from an error response.
